        !            33: C This code uses 64-bit operations on `o' and `g' registers.  It doesn't
        !            34: C require that `o' registers' upper 32 bits are preserved by the operating
        !            35: C system, but if they are not, they must be zeroed.  That is indeed what
        !            36: C happens at least on Slowaris 2.5 and 2.6.
        !            37:
        !            38: C On UltraSPARC 1 and 2, this code runs at 3 cycles/limb from the Dcache and at
        !            39: C about 10 cycles/limb from the Ecache.
